Fortnite Silenced Specter is a Military Weapon and makes use of Light Bullets, which is out there in Epic and Legendary versions. It is one of the rapid-fire weapons but has less accuracy or range, has minimal recoil and quick aim recovery. Unique of this weapon is that equipped having a suppressor that tremendously reduces the distance that enemies hear gunshots. Silenced Specter is divided into Silenced Specter (legendary) and Silenced Specter (epic).
Silenced Specter (legendary) | Silenced Specter (epic) | ||
---|---|---|---|
Name | Value | Name | Value |
Damage | 19 | Damage | 18 |
Crit Chance | 20% | Crit Chance | 10% |
Crit Damage | +75% | Crit Damage | +75% |
Fire Rate | 14.16 | Fire Rate | 14.16 |
Magazine Size | 30 | Magazine Size | 30 |
Range | 3584 | Range | 3584 |
Durability | 375 | Durability | 280 |
Durability per Use | 0.05 | Durability per Use | 0.05 |
Reload Time | 2 | Reload Time | 2 |
Ammo Type | Ammo: Light Bullets | Ammo Type | Ammo: Light Bullets |
Ammo Cost | 1 | Ammo Cost | 1 |
Impact | 52 | Impact | 52 |

Silenced Specter vs Siegebreaker
Siegebreaker is a fully automatic rifle and makes use of Light Bullets. Siegebreaker features a slightly larger impact and range which does make a difference. Even when "the maths has been done" in the game the two guns are nevertheless each worth working with collectively.
The range is the biggest component. Silenced Specter is good with dual crit bonuses for up close DPS, and the Siegebreaker is greater for mid-longer ranges.
